Andrew James Clay Pomade Review

Hold

  • High hold.
  • Holds all day with no shine.

Smell

  • Subtle and not overwhelming scent.

Look

  • Enhances natural curls.
  • Holds brushed back look.
  • Adds texture & volume.

Texture

  • Gives hair natural looking body.
  • Creates tousled beach waves.
  • Enhances waves and curls.

Cost

  • This product costs ~$15.

Hair Type

  • Thick hair is no problem for this product.
  • Great for natural and matte looks.
  • Easier to handle than gel, no greasy or heavy feel.

Does It Last?

  • All day hold.

Easy To Wash Out?

  • Washes out easily.

Adding Too Much?

  • Hair can become greasy.

Product Summary:

Andrew James Clay Pomade is an effective styling product, especially suitable for achieving a natural, matte look with strong hold. It's particularly adept at taming thick hair and managing flyaways, and it emits a subtle scent that enhances the styling experience without being overwhelming.

One of the notable features of this clay pomade is its longevity. A single jar can last up to two years, thanks to the minimal amount needed to create the desired hairstyle. It's versatile in its styling capabilities, enhancing curls and waves for tousled beach looks or maintaining a sleek, brushed-back appearance. Additionally, it contributes to adding volume and body to hair.

Comparable to salon brands in terms of quality, Andrew James Clay Pomade is easy to handle and apply, avoiding any greasy or heavy feeling. It washes out with ease, adding to its convenience. However, users should be cautious about the quantity used, as overapplication can result in hair appearing greasy. Despite this, the product provides a great shine without leaving hair sticky, making it a well-rounded choice for various hair styling needs.
